Why a Precise Bag Cutter Matters for Food Storage

A straight cut on a vacuum sealer bag is about more than just neatness; it’s about resource management. Every crooked cut that needs to be re-trimmed wastes a half-inch or more of bag material. That doesn’t sound like much, but when you’re processing hundreds of bags a year from your garden, poultry, and hunts, that waste adds up to entire rolls.

More importantly, a jagged or angled cut is the number one enemy of a reliable seal. The heat bar on your sealer needs a flat, clean edge to create an airtight bond. An uneven edge can create tiny channels where air can seep in over time, leading to freezer burn and spoiled food.

Ultimately, a precise cutter saves you time, money, and the food you worked so hard to produce. It turns a potentially frustrating task into a smooth, efficient process. When you’re facing a mountain of produce on a hot August evening, that efficiency is priceless.

Making Straight Cuts: Tips for Any Sealer Model

No matter what cutter you use, good technique is key to minimizing waste. Before you cut, always make sure the bag material is pulled flat and taut. Any wrinkles or slack in the material can lead to a wavy, uneven edge.

If you’re stuck using scissors, don’t just eyeball it. Use a straight edge as a guide. A simple metal ruler or even the edge of a cutting board can give you a line to follow. This small extra step mimics the precision of a built-in slide cutter and dramatically improves your results.

Finally, remember the golden rule: measure twice, cut once. Before making that final slice, double-check that you’ve left enough room—at least three inches of headspace is a good rule of thumb—between your food and the planned seal. A perfectly straight cut on a bag that’s too short is still a wasted bag.
